2007 Dodge Ram vs. 1995 Lancia Delta
To start off, 2007 Dodge Ram is newer by 12 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1995 Lancia Delta.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1995 Lancia Delta would be higher. At 6,688 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Dodge Ram is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Dodge Ram (350 HP @ 3013 RPM) has 276 more horse power than 1995 Lancia Delta. (74 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Dodge Ram should accelerate faster than 1995 Lancia Delta.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Dodge Ram weights approximately 2029 kg more than 1995 Lancia Delta.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2007 Dodge Ram (827 Nm @ 1400 RPM) has 702 more torque (in Nm) than 1995 Lancia Delta. (125 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2007 Dodge Ram will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1995 Lancia Delta.
